Ikea mate, I was finding it hard last week to find what I wanted within my budget. I started off with a basic Micke desk ( £60 ) and 2 Micke 4 drawer cabinets ( £45 each ) then a corner piece Linnmon ( £45 ) and a straight top Linnmon ( £15 ) It worked out great, I had to go down a seperate top route as I have water pipes going along the bottom of my wall and the desk wont sit flat against it, but having a top on a desk allows me to have it flush against the wall. And it is huge. These pics are crap but you get the idea, and I'm in the middle of sorting it all out hence the mess.
